Slippage

Slippage is the difference between the expected price of a swap and the price actually executed, caused by price movement and limited liquidity. Automation caps slippage with a minimum-output limit so a rebalance or close can’t execute at a bad price.

When Super9MM’s keeper swaps during a rebalance or a close, it enforces a slippage limit derived from a manipulation-resistant price. If the swap would exceed that limit, it reverts rather than filling at a loss.
